Justin Timberlake’s Tour Takes a Hit: Back Injury Cancels Third Show

Justin Timberlake has cancelled his December 2 concert in Oklahoma City due to a back injury sustained during a New Orleans show. This is his third cancellation recently, following struggles with bronchitis and a previous undisclosed injury. Timberlake is trying to make a comeback with his Forget Tomorrow World Tour after a five-year hiatus, but health issues are throwing a wrench into his plans.
Justin Timberlake has sadly had to chop, chop, chop his way out of a third tour performance thanks to a pesky back injury! The charming crooner made the announcement via Instagram on November 30, letting his Oklahoma City fans know that his December 2 show was a no-go.
“I hurt my back in Nola and my doctors have instructed me to rest a little bit longer. Thank you for your support — y’all know I hate doing this,” he shared with a heartfelt apology. The injury reared its ugly head during a performance in New Orleans on November 25.
Oh, but that’s not all! Timberlake, who’s been trying to get his tour groove on with the Forget Tomorrow World Tour, has had more than his fair share of misfortunes on stage. Just a month prior, he had to delay several shows due to bronchitis and laryngitis. “I’m so sorry to say I do need to reschedule the next few shows,” he lamented back in October.
And remember that October 8 show in New Jersey? Yeah, it didn’t happen either, thanks to an undisclosed injury — Timberlake was genuinely disappointed, promising to reschedule ASAP while probably nursing a sore back on the couch.
